clan DIABOLIK Posted July 21, 2012 Share Posted July 21, 2012 Hello I'd like to prevent skilled player to join the team where already players are skilled. So I use :g_teamForceBalance 1 I also have:set g_shuffle_rating 3set g_killRating 1set g_playerRating 1set g_playerRating_mapPad 50set g_playerRating_minplayers 6set g_stats 3 But I am wrong somewhere, as anyone can join any team ... PS: I use 0.5.2 not patched. Thanks in advance silEnT team !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ted July 24, 2012 Author Share Posted July 24, 2012 Help ! I We need an engeneer ! Quote Link to comment Share on other sites More sharing options...
Dragonji Posted July 24, 2012 Share Posted July 24, 2012 You can only prevent people from joining the team with more players AFAIK.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ted July 24, 2012 Author Share Posted July 24, 2012 Thanks Dragon, you have opened my eyes: I read again the doc, and it never talks about an "anti-join" system, but a fine-grained system to calculate players skills, and notifying in-game when game is unfair.I must stop beer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 19, 2012 Author Share Posted August 19, 2012 (edited) Hi everybody xD Even when the "fair difference" is higher than 5 (verified with !howfair), there aren't any messages displayed automatically.I use these cvars: set g_killRating 1 set g_playerRating 1 set g_playerRating_mapPad 50 set g_playerRating_minplayers 5 set g_stats 3 set g_unevenTeamDiff 5 set g_unevenTeamFreq 30 but I probably miss something, or simply it doesn't work ?? Thanks in advance, silEnT and CommunET lol PS: will be back only tonight, bye Edited August 19, 2012 by clan DIABOLIK Quote Link to comment Share on other sites More sharing options...
Aniky Posted August 21, 2012 Share Posted August 21, 2012 I assume u have g_teamForceBalance set to 1?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 21, 2012 Author Share Posted August 21, 2012 Affirmative! xD Quote Link to comment Share on other sites More sharing options...
Aniky Posted August 21, 2012 Share Posted August 21, 2012 Have u tried changing the value of g_unevenTeamDiff on something smaller i.e 3? Its strange how come it doesn't show the message even tho u are running all the cvars needed for it.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 21, 2012 Author Share Posted August 21, 2012 Thanks for your help Aniky, so I've just set it now to 3, and will connect to verify in some moments: only 3 players now Quote Link to comment Share on other sites More sharing options...
Dragonji Posted August 21, 2012 Share Posted August 21, 2012 Even when the "fair difference" is higher than 5 (verified with !howfair), there aren't any messages displayed automatically.I use these cvars: (...) set g_unevenTeamDiff 5 set g_unevenTeamFreq 30 but I probably miss something, or simply it doesn't work ??Those cvars have nothing to do with !howfair.http://mygamingtalk.com/wiki/index.php/Silent_Mod_Server_Cvar#g_unevenTeamDiffhttp://mygamingtalk.com/wiki/index.php/Silent_Mod_Server_Cvar#g_unevenTeamFreq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 21, 2012 Author Share Posted August 21, 2012 (edited) Ooops OK I thought that the g_unevenTeamDiff was related to by !howfair, telling the " UNEVEN blabla Difference 3,5", thanks Dragon Setting it to 3, I see now the message when I join a team, or when I join spectator (not when the map begin because my computer is very slow, so it is to late to see it, except scrolling up the console) But, the problem is present : it is not displayed at the frequency g_unevenTeamFreq : I've lowered it to 10 and message is not displayed each 10s, only at team change. Has anyone this feature enabled on his server, please ? [DIABOLIK]$mart Edited August 21, 2012 by clan DIABOLIK Quote Link to comment Share on other sites More sharing options...
Management hellreturn Posted August 21, 2012 Management Share Posted August 21, 2012 set g_unevenTeamDiff 5set g_unevenTeamFreq 30 When your teams will be off by 5 players i..e if team A has 10 players and team B has 16 players, it will tell message that teams are off. Try this: set g_unevenTeamDiff 3set g_unevenTeamFreq 30 See if that works for you.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 21, 2012 Author Share Posted August 21, 2012 Yes it works now, but the message only comes when you switch team.Not important anyway, just curious. Bye all ... time to sleep for me now xD Quote Link to comment Share on other sites More sharing options...
Aniky Posted August 22, 2012 Share Posted August 22, 2012 Well the message is supposed to come when the limit of the uneven teams that u have set is over that particular number if i got it correct. And msg should come anytime that case happens no matter if ur switching teams. Quote Link to comment Share on other sites More sharing options...
Management hellreturn Posted August 22, 2012 Management Share Posted August 22, 2012 Yes it works now, but the message only comes when you switch team.Not important anyway, just curious. Bye all ... time to sleep for me now xD I will try to test it in few days... i believe message should show every 30 seconds depending on the variable you have set.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 22, 2012 Author Share Posted August 22, 2012 OK thanks guys, I will also give other infos if the situation evoluates (1st idea: maybe a simple stop/start server will do the trick - even if it does not run on Windows loool)BB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 23, 2012 Author Share Posted August 23, 2012 I definitively think there is a bug: I've setset g_unevenTeamDiff 2 set g_unevenTeamFreq 30and message does not print each 30s, only at team switch Quote Link to comment Share on other sites More sharing options...
Management gaoesa Posted August 23, 2012 Management Share Posted August 23, 2012 You also had some other time related issue? Quote Link to comment Share on other sites More sharing options...
clan DIABOLIK Posted August 23, 2012 Author Share Posted August 23, 2012 (edited) oops stop APOLOGIZE it works like a charm !!!! Maybe the server reboot did the trick, but I well have the message each 30s. Thanks for your work and attention in correcting potential bugs, this mod is really THE mod xD Can we close the thread, such a shame for me lool Edited August 23, 2012 by clan DIABOLIK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.